Where is the chassis number stamping on the Besturn X80?
2 Answers
The chassis number stamping on the Besturn X80 is located below the windshield in front of the driver's seat, which can be seen by the owner from the outside. Introduction to the chassis number: The chassis number is the VIN code. VIN is the abbreviation of Vehicle Identification Number. Regulations regarding the chassis number: The SAE standard stipulates that the VIN code consists of 17 characters, hence it is commonly referred to as the 17-digit code. It contains information such as the vehicle manufacturer, year, model, body type and code, engine code, and assembly location. Correctly interpreting the VIN code is very important for owners to accurately identify the vehicle model and perform correct diagnosis and maintenance.
I've been driving the Besturn X80 for quite some time now, and initially, I couldn't find where the VIN stamp was located. The most common spot is at the lower right corner of the windshield when viewed from outside the car, right in that little corner in front of the driver's seat, where there's a black number engraved on the edge of the glass. Sometimes it's hard to see on rainy days, so I use a wet cloth to wipe away the dust. Another location is when you open the driver's door, there's a stamp on the door sill. There's also a plate in the engine compartment, but it's not very durable.
